CE17 OVC is a 2017 Citroen C4 Cactus in Black with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 2017 Citroen C4 Cactus models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.1% with a typical mileage of 39,942 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The Citroen C4 Cactus typically stays on UK roads for around 11 years. At 9 years old, this Citroen C4 Cactus is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
